About Reflecting on Nana

First published in 1991, this book radically challenged the view of Nana as the story of an old fashioned femme fatale and reinterprets her as a feminist heroine who manages to overturn patriarchy. The author shows how Nana confronts the traditional social order and offers an alternative version. This work gives not just an original approach to the heroine herself, but the story of Zoläs struggle with his vision of her and the subversive values she represents. This book will be of interest to students of literature and feminism.
